【问题标题】:Play! 2.0 using Eclipse builder玩! 2.0 使用 Eclipse 构建器
【发布时间】:2012-09-15 08:40:22
【问题描述】:

有没有办法让 Play 使用 Eclipse 编译的类,并让 Eclipse 生成隐藏在模板后面的 Scala 类?

我运行 Play 控制台(播放调试),然后从控制台中,我使用“~run”来不断编译。

问题是:

1) 当我对 HTML 模板进行更改时,Eclipse 需要刷新,因为它是 Play Console 正在重新生成 Scala 类,而 Eclispe 对此一无所知。

2) Eclipse 和 Play 都是编译类,这让我的 CPU 异常发热。但是仅仅关闭 Eclipse 自动构建并没有帮助,因为我仍然在 Eclipse 认为存在编译器问题的地方得到一堆红色下划线。所以我必须进行刷新和手动构建。

这些会导致糟糕的程序员体验,那么,是我做错了什么,还是我必须等到有人开发一个替换外部 Play 控制台的 Eclipse 插件?还是我应该恢复到 vi?

【问题讨论】:

  • 一个月前我问了同样的问题:stackoverflow.com/questions/10932482/…。现在我通过购买一台新电脑解决了这个问题:D
  • 开发团队是否计划构建一个 Eclipse 插件?那可能更环保...

标签: playframework playframework-2.0 typesafe-stack


【解决方案1】:

您可以将 Eclipse 设置为在文件系统上的文件更改时自动刷新您的工作区:

窗口 > 首选项 > 常规 > 工作区 > 使用本机挂钩或轮询刷新

适合我。

【讨论】:

  • 是让 Eclipse 也构建,还是关闭 Eclipse Build?
  • 我的笔记本电脑 CPU 不是很好,Eclipse 有一段时间没有响应。如果我只是在 Eclipse 中开发 Scala,那还不错。但是 Play 开发并不有趣 :-( 我怀疑是由于双重编译。
  • 您使用的是什么操作系统?我使用 Linux,I/O 性能比 Windows 好。
  • 我重新安装了 Eclipse。似乎是某个插件完成了所有工作。我现在只剩下 Scala IDE 和 JBoss AS 工具了。
猜你喜欢
  • 2012-09-15
  • 1970-01-01
  • 2013-08-21
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多